A new bill proposed by Washington State Senator Kevin Van De Wege would create a memorial to honor firefighters who die in the line of duty.
Legislation to build the memorial was passed Friday by the Senate State Government & Elections Committee. If signed into law, SB 5946 would allow the memorial to be built and maintained with funds from a ‘non-appropriated account.

The Line of Duty Death Memorial Service for Walla Walla Fire Department Engineer Paramedic Ryan Pleasants is set for Jan. 27 at the Walla Walla Community College Dietrich Activity Center.
Pleasants was found dead while on duty on Sun., Jan. 7. His cause of death was determined to be a “significant cardiac event,” according to a press release from the City of Walla Walla.

Six families are displaced after a heavy fire broke out at an apartment building in Warren.
Firefighters rushing to Arlington Avenue around 2 a.m. Friday found heavy smoke and flames shooting from the top floor.
Bristol, Warren and Providence firefighters are on scene and still working to put out hot spots.
